: The Department of Budget and Management issued Local Budget Memorandum No. 90 dated June 13, 2024, titled, โ€œ Indicative FY 2025 National Tax Allotment (NTA) Shares of Local Government Units (LGUs) and Guidelines on the Preparation of the FY 2025 Annual Budgets of LGUs.โ€

: Department of Budget and Management (DBM) Secretary Amenah F. Pangandaman shared that the Philippine government is set to finalize a comprehensive study on the potential salary adjustment for government workers by the first half of 2024.

Spearheaded by the DBM and the Governance Commission for GOCCs (GCG), the study aims to ensure a competitive and equitable compensation package that aligns with the Administrationโ€™s commitment to honing a resilient and future-ready civil service.

: Department of Budget and Management (DBM) Secretary Amenah F. Pangandaman supports the decision of President Ferdinand R. Marcos Jr. (PBBM) to extend the employment of government employees under the contract of service (COS) and job order (JO) until December 31, 2025.

The decision was made during a sectoral meeting with the DBM, the Department of the Interior and Local Government (DILG), the Civil Service Commission (CSC), and the Commission on Audit (COA) held at the Malacaรฑang Palace on April 24, 2024.

In addition, PBBM instructed the government agencies to implement strategies that will develop the skills and capabilities of COS and JO workers in securing permanent positions.

: The Department of Budget and Management (DBM) issued Local Budget Circular No. 156 dated April 15, 2024, to prescribe the guidelines and procedures for the implementation of Personal Services (PS) limitation on local government budgets and the determination of waived PS items in the computation of PS limitation.

This is pursuant to Section 95 of the General Provisions of the FY 2024 General Appropriations Act.

: The Department of Budget and Management and the Commission on Audit issued Joint Circular No. 2024-1 dated January 30, 2024 on the โ€œRevised Manual on the Disposal of Government Properties.โ€

The said Manual provides the requirements that government agencies must adhere to before the commencement of disposal activities and identifies the duties and responsibilities of accountable personnel, as well as the procedures and methods in the conduct of disposal.

๐——๐—•๐—  ๐˜๐—ฟ๐—ฎ๐—ถ๐—ป๐˜€ ๐Ÿณ๐Ÿฌ๐Ÿฌ ๐—Ÿ๐—ผ๐—ฐ๐—ฎ๐—น ๐—•๐˜‚๐—ฑ๐—ด๐—ฒ๐˜ ๐—ข๐—ณ๐—ณ๐—ถ๐—ฐ๐—ฒ๐—ฟ๐˜€, ๐—ฃ๐—™๐—  ๐—ฝ๐—ฟ๐—ฎ๐—ฐ๐˜๐—ถ๐˜๐—ถ๐—ผ๐—ป๐—ฒ๐—ฟ๐˜€ ๐—ถ๐—ป ๐—Ÿ๐—ฒ๐—ด๐—ฎ๐˜‡๐—ฝ๐—ถ ๐—–๐—ถ๐˜๐˜†

The conduct of the Public Financial Management (PFM) Competency Program for Local Government Units (LGUs) continues in Legazpi City, where about 700 budget officers from the provinces of Albay, Camarines Norte, Camarines Sur, Catanduanes, Masbate, and Sorsogon, and other cities and municipalities in Region V, were capacitated on PFM policies and reforms from March 6 to 8, 2024.

The PFMCP for LGUs is composed of three tracks on PFMCP foundation, budgeting, and procurement which are taught by subject-matter experts from the Department of Budget and Management (DBM). The sessions were led by DBM Undersecretary Margaux V. Salcedo who highlighted the governmentโ€™s macroeconomic targets and budget priorities under the Philippine Development Plan 2023-2028. Other subject-matter experts include Government Procurement Policy Board Technical Support Office (GPPB-TSO) Executive Director Rowena Candice M. Ruiz and DBM-Procurement Service Executive Director Dennis S. Santiago on procurement updates; DBM Systems and Productivity Improvement Bureau (SPIB) Director John Aries S. Macaspac on Internal Control and Internal Audit; and Local Government and Regional Coordination Bureau (LGRCB) Director Ryan S. Lita on Budget Authorization and Budget Overview.

Organized by the DBM, in partnership with the Association of Local Budget Officers in Region V Inc. (ALBOREV), the PFM Competency Program was designed to deepen the knowledge of local budget officers on different thematic areas such as budgeting, procurement, cash management, accounting, auditing, and even relationship management. Ultimately, the program aims to assist LGUs in fully utilizing their respective shares in the National Tax Allotment, among other budget allocations, and in providing quality public services to their constituents.

DBM Secretary Amenah F. Pangandaman, who served as the keynote speaker, emphasized that the Department is complementing the efforts of LGUs and persistently working hard on ensuring that the National Budget will have felt and transformative results.

The conduct of the PFMCP for LGUs is aligned with the DBMโ€™s commitment to improving the governmentโ€™s spending efficiency by encouraging LGUs to practice sound fiscal management and allocative efficiency and ultimately, promote the timely and effective implementation of local programs and projects aimed at building a prosperous, inclusive, and resilient society.

: The Department of Budget and Management issued Circular Letter No. 2024-7 dated February 27 to provide the guidelines on the use of digital and electronic signature for the Notice of Step Increment (NOSI) and Notice of Salary Adjustment (NOSA).

The said circular is issued to provide departments, agencies, state universities and colleges, government-owned or controlled corporations, and local government units with guidelines for using digital/electronic signatures in issuing the NOSIs/NOSAs to their respective personnel.
